Habitat for Humanity's ReStore celebrates third anniversary

April 25, 2011

Sussex County Habitat for Humanity celebrated the third anniversary of the opening of its ReStore April 20. The ReStore in Georgetown is a resale center for appliances, cabinets, doors and windows, furniture, tools and some building materials. Promoting reuse and recycling ReStore provides an environmentally and socially responsible way to keep good, reusable materials out of the waste stream while providing funding for the construction of simple, decent, and affordable homes for Sussex County families.

Habitat also announced that in the past three quarters of the 2010-11 fiscal year, ReStore has raised $75,000 in profits to go toward the construction costs of a future Habitat home in Sussex County.
